So I was reading my monthly mags you know Cosmo Glamour and Elle and they seem to be contradicting each other. Cosmoplitan seems to think that red lips are out but Glamour says their in. Who do you believe? In MY OPINION red lips are not out. They are still in full swing and will always be they are a classy look that gives women confidence and makes them stand out just remember if your going to do a red lip don't go dark on the eyeshadow.

Forever 21 is my absolute favorite place to shop especially when I'm on a budget. They always have the latest trends at affordable prices especially now during the recession. So if you're a recessionista you should check out www.forever21.com The thing that I like the most is the shop by outfit section. If your going though a style block (my version of a writing block) you should check it out! They have great stylists working on great outfits that can work for anyone. What's even better they now have swimsuits, so you can be stylish every day of the year. Here's a taste of what I'm talking about:

Oh and if your looking for great shoes at a low cost forever 21 is the place for you! I just bought the cutest pair of platforms for just $29.80. And now they even have men's clothing! Just always remember to be fashionable does not always mean expensive!
